EVENTS CALENDAR March 9 The Rio Grande Valley Gid-RDone Bluegrass Band, made up of Valley Winter Texans, will perform from 4 to 6 p.m. at the Roadrunner RV Park, 1222 Chavez Rd. in Alamo. This event is a fundraiser for St. Jude’s. All performance proceeds to St. Jude’s Children’s Research Hospital. This will be their last performance of the season. March 10 Come enjoy the live outdoor concert with the Mariachi Margaritas at Quinta Mazatlán. Get a feel of South Texas and the Rio Grande Valley with the cultural sounds of mariachi music. The second concert of the Music in the Park 2022 series will feature traditional songs from the all-female mariachi group from Brownsville, the Mariachi Margaritas, on Thursday March 10th from 6:30 p.m.-7:30 p.m. Reserve your free tickets now at quintamazatlan. ticketleap.com. Please follow current COVID-19 Safety Guidelines while in park. For more information, contact Quinta Mazatlán at (956) 681-3370 and follow Quinta Mazatlán on social media. March 12 Join us at our Mazatlan Morning on Saturday, March 12th from 9 a.m. to noon for the Native Plant Sale, Talk, Walk and Seed Bombing. John Brush, McAllen Urban Ecologist, will present a program at 10 a.m. titled “Quinta in Bloom” highlighting the beautiful native flowers around the sanctuary. Mike Heep, Valley’s native plant nursery owner, will sell plants from 9 a.m. to noon on Saturday with a presentation at 11 a.m. It is a great opportunity to ask questions about what to grow in your garden.
